Connect
 Surface Area of a rectangular prism:
 The area AROUND the rectangular prism
 Think about it: How much wrapping paper do I need to wrap the

box?
Connect
How do you find the surface area?
 Find the area of the 6 faces and then add them up.

 Step 1: Identify the measurement of the length, width, and







height.
Step 2: Find the area of two sides (Length x Height) x 2
Step 3: Find the area of adjacent sides (Width x Height) x 2 sides
Step 4: Find the area of ends (Length x Width) x2 ends
Step 5: Add the three areas together to find the surface area
Step 6: Don’t forget to use the proper conventions
Connect
 Use the nets of the rectangular prism to calculate the surface

area.
 Label the Faces
 Calculate the area of each face
 Add up the totals

Connect
 Use this formula:
 SA (Rectangular Prism) = 2 x (L x W + L x H + Hx W)
